    I had partial power loss in our new 2017 3791RD. After many, many, many trips to a dealer and thousands of miles traveled to fix it, it turns out a very simple fix. The 50 amp input plug on the back of the rv was loose. So bad, that when I pulled it out of the wall simply by removing 4 screws, the 50 amp wires fell off the back of the plug. 4 wires total. 2 fell out and the clamp screws were never tightened at the factory. They were completely backset tight against the stop. Never were they tight. I tightened the 2 wires up, and all my problems have gone away. I had charging issues, the hot water heater would quit, ceiling fan quit, left side outlets quit too every time this happened. We found the problem by accident. Simply wiggle the power cord at the plug, back and forth. Instant failure of everything listed. It's a wonder we didn't have a fire. There was arcing evidence inside the plug. Keystone supplied a new plug and a new 50 amp cord free of charge thru the dealer.
